Output 3a0066509bb0e570cd95dd6c1487b33372dad6f93328b5985d8cf8506f9e6199:94

value
58962191
script pubkey
OP_0 OP_PUSHBYTES_20 34b3955e1c194475be55f7df77aecb2f2c948d42
address
bc1qxjee2hsur9z8t0j47l0h0tkt9ukffr2z6l5jv4
transaction
3a0066509bb0e570cd95dd6c1487b33372dad6f93328b5985d8cf8506f9e6199
confirmations
203966
spent
true